91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

Oracle調度器如何優化工作進程

小樊
82
2024-09-16 17:30:28
欄目: 云計算

Oracle調度器是一個用于管理和調度數據庫后臺進程的組件

  1. 合理設置進程數量:根據系統資源和工作負載,合理設置進程數量。過多的進程可能導致系統資源競爭,降低性能;過少的進程可能導致處理能力不足,增加響應時間。

  2. 使用并行執行:Oracle支持并行執行,可以同時處理多個任務。通過設置并行度,可以提高任務處理速度。但請注意,過高的并行度可能導致系統資源競爭,降低性能。

  3. 優化任務分配:根據任務類型和優先級,合理分配任務到不同的進程。例如,將CPU密集型任務分配給專門的進程,以充分利用多核處理器資源。

  4. 使用資源管理器:Oracle資源管理器可以根據系統資源和工作負載,動態調整進程的資源分配。通過設置資源限制,可以確保關鍵任務得到優先處理,避免資源競爭。

  5. 監控和調整:定期監控系統性能,分析瓶頸和資源競爭情況。根據監控結果,調整進程數量、并行度等參數,以達到最佳性能。

  6. 使用連接池:連接池可以復用數據庫連接,減少連接建立和釋放的開銷。這對于高并發場景尤為重要,可以提高系統吞吐量和響應速度。

  7. 優化SQL語句:避免使用低效的SQL語句,如全表掃描、多表連接等。使用索引、分區等技術,提高查詢性能。同時,合理使用緩存和批處理,減少數據庫訪問次數。

  8. 使用適當的鎖機制:根據業務需求選擇合適的鎖機制,如行鎖、表鎖等。過度使用鎖可能導致資源競爭和死鎖,降低性能。

  9. 數據庫優化:定期進行數據庫維護,如表分析、索引重建等。這有助于提高數據庫性能,從而間接優化工作進程。

  10. 升級硬件和軟件:根據業務需求,升級服務器硬件和數據庫軟件,以提高系統性能。這可能包括升級CPU、內存、存儲等硬件資源,以及升級Oracle數據庫版本。

0
玉林市| 德兴市| 乌拉特后旗| 穆棱市| 永丰县| 桃园市| 平南县| 繁昌县| 吴旗县| 怀宁县| 六枝特区| 铜陵市| 仁寿县| 屏东县| 鄢陵县| 察哈| 根河市| 保靖县| 聂拉木县| 舞阳县| 偃师市| 辉县市| 武穴市| 上杭县| 永丰县| 原平市| 固阳县| 普安县| 德兴市| 长兴县| 杭锦旗| 尼木县| 顺昌县| 中卫市| 武宁县| 中西区| 沂水县| 雷波县| 吉林省| 灵宝市| 镇雄县|